A network technician needs to set up two public facing web servers and watns to ensure that if they are compromised the intruder
Taya2010 [7]

Answer:

D. Place them in the demilitarized zone.

Explanation:

Demilitarized zone(DMZ) is a logical or physical sub network that contains and gives exposure to an organization's external-facing services to an not trust worthy network, basically a larger network like Internet. It's purpose is to add an extra layer of security in an organization's LAN(local area network).So we conclude that DMZ is best way so that intruder cannot access the intranet.
